JG Charitable Trust
About This Funder
The JG Charitable Trust, established in 1983 and registered with the Charity Commission, is a grant-making body dedicated to advancing general charitable purposes by providing financial support to charities, voluntary organisations, and the general public across England and Wales. With annual income exceeding £250,000 and expenditure around £140,000, it upholds core values of transparency, accountability, and prudent financial management through robust policies on reserves, risk, and incident reporting. Its distinctive generalist approach offers broad, flexible funding without narrow thematic restrictions, making it a reliable partner for diverse public-good initiatives.
The trust funds a wide array of charitable activities, including project work, core costs, and unrestricted grants to both organisations and individuals, with no limits on specific causes, beneficiary groups, or programmes—as long as they align with charitable law and demonstrate community benefit. It prioritises accessible support for grassroots efforts serving people and communities, from small voluntary groups to larger institutions.
Eligible applicants include UK-registered charities and constituted community groups operating in England and Wales, with no income thresholds, religious restrictions, or preliminary enquiries required. Typical grants range from £500 to £3,000, occasionally larger for modest projects, but unlikely to cover full costs. Unsolicited applications are accepted via email or post using a completed form, including project details and financials; submit by quarterly deadlines of 31 March, 30 June, 30 September, or 31 December for review at January, April, July, or October trustee meetings, with outcomes notified within four weeks. Exclusions cover trading subsidiaries and trustee remuneration; uniquely, it provides no application feedback and eschews online portals for a straightforward, trustee-led process.
